Abstract:
Newly considered both Big data Apache Hadoop and
Apache Spark It is an important techniques in managing
huge databases and thus this article provides an overview
of Hadoop MapReduce. Apache Spark is used in big data
increase the number of users of social networking sites of
various types or industries. Big Data can be classified in
the form of structured, unstructured and semi-structured
form. Traditional data processing techniques are unable to
store and process this huge amount of data, and due to this,
they face many challenges in processing Big Data and
demands of the end user. This paper also shows a
comparison of certain criteria to determine which is better
accordingly.
Keywords: Big Data; Hadoop; Map Reduce; Spark.
